As a peace deal signed by the Central African govt and arise groups comes into force on Friday, the leaders of 3R and UPC contain officially dissolved their actions in a ceremony in Bangui led by President Faustin-Archange Touadéra.
Classic Sembé Bobo, head of the Union for Peace (UPC), and Ali Darassa of Return, Reclamation and Rehabilitation (3R), confirmed the disbanding of their political and armed forces wings during the occasion on Thursday.
Wearing blue and white boubous, the 2 warlords took turns placing Kalashnikovs on a desk, marking the live of hostilities, reported RFI’s correspondent Rolf Steve Domia-leu.
The laying down of palms follows a ceasefire settlement signed between Bangui, UPC and 3R on 19 April in N’Djamena, with Chadian mediation.
“In the name of our movement, the 3R, we are here to answer the call for peace, we commit to honouring this agreement for the supreme interest of the nation,” Bobo acknowledged. “I assure you that I will respect all the commitments I have made.”
Darassa made an identical promise and entreated the Central African govt to finish the same. He known as for safety ensures to be upheld, signatory groups to be included in running public affairs and warring parties to be integrated into reintegration and community development plans.

Disarmament and rehabilitation
CAR has been mired in violence since a coalition of largely northern and predominantly Muslim rebels is named Seleka, or “Alliance” in the Sango language, seized energy in March 2013 after ousting president Francois Bozize.
Their dominance gave rise to the opposing anti-balaka Christian militias.
The UN mounted the Minusca peacekeeping operation in 2014.
Touadéra used to be elected in 2015 and re-elected in 2020 but orderly parts of the nation contain remained below the alter of armed groups.
In February 2019 Bangui signed the Political Agreement for Peace and Reconciliation in the Central African Republic (APPR-RCA) in Khartoum with 14 armed groups, but makes an strive at integrating arise factions into advise structures failed and the main ones withdrew.
The settlement used to be revived after lengthy negotiations between Bangui, the 3R and UPC, brokered by Chadian President Mahamat Idriss Déby Itno, and signed on 19 April.
It fashions out a detailed route of to incorporate arise warring parties into the navy and safety forces.
Opponents from the UPC and 3R contain already been relocated to 5 cantonment sites in arise strongholds in the east and north-west of the nation, and registered.
They’re going to then be disarmed.

Old rebels deemed fit for service will begin training, with a look to joining the Central African Armed Forces (FACA) or one in all the assorted branches of the nation’s defence and safety forces, as pledged by the government. Opponents deemed unfit will snatch pleasure in the nation’s Disarmament, Demobilisation and Reintegration programme (DDR).

‘Most modern settlement no longer signal of weak point’
As mediator and guarantor of the 19 April settlement, Chad will seemingly be to blame for ensuring its effective implementation.
During Thursday’s ceremony, Chad’s Defence Minister Issakha Malloua Djamous entreated all parties to remain dedicated to its spirit. “Ongoing instability in the Central African Republic could destabilise Chad,” he warned, calling on all parties to work “hand in hand”.
President Touadéra acknowledged all americans’s efforts. “This latest agreement is not a sign of weakness,” he acknowledged, expressing his conviction that “dialogue will contribute to the development of the Central African Republic”.
He reiterated calls for “an immediate end to hostilities through a ceasefire, a permanent renunciation of the use of weapons and violence, and the handing over of arms to the government within the framework of the DDR process”.
Bangui is additionally in negotiations with varied arise actions, including the anti-balaka militias and the Patriotic Circulate for the Central African Republic (MPC) – both of which contain expressed a willingness to rejoin the 2019 settlement.
